How does Badfish, the Sublime tribute band, continue to capture the music of a timeless moment, while maintaining sold-out shows and growing popularity for over a quarter century? For founder Scott Begin it’s simple — have a blast while staying true to the music of Sublime. On Wednesday, Nov. 20, one of Key West’s most popular bands returns to the Key West Theater. Britt Myers catches up with Scott Begin on the Florida Keys Weekly Podcast to discuss how a new generation of fans is embracing the unique ska-reggae music of Sublime, some of his favorite memories from the road and why he loves stopping in Key West to perform for fans. Peyton Porter is a rising music star who has already played the Grand Ole Opry, while sharing stages with names like Wille Nelson and Tim McGraw. As her star ascends, Porter visited Key West this past January and took some time on our podcast to discuss road life, navigating Nashville and how her small town Georgia roots keep her grounded throughout the journey.
